Giter Club home page Giter Club logo

cfb-2's Introduction

CFB Rankings

This is a simple resume-based algorithm I developed for ranking college football teams. It just uses wins and losses.

  • Preaseason rankings can bias a poll's effectiveness. To overcome this, this algorithm uses randomly generated preaseason rankings.
  • In most polls a recent win or loss tends to be counted more strongly than earlier wins. This algorithm randomly shuffles the records of all games in order to alleviate this problem.
  • Only wins and losses are counted in the algorithm (see below). Strength of schedule is built in, because winning against a team ranked higher in an iteration moves your team up.

See docs/about.md for more information on how to compile the program and how the algorithm works.

Current rankings

After 11 weeks of play in the 2017-2018 season:

Full rankings

Rank Team Record Score
1 Alabama Alabama 10-0 0.631117
2 Wisconsin Wisconsin 10-0 0.628449
3 Miami (FL) Miami (FL) 9-0 0.609664
4 Clemson Clemson 9-1 0.608251
5 UCF UCF 9-0 0.608147
6 Oklahoma Oklahoma 9-1 0.606280
7 Georgia Georgia 9-1 0.598680
8 USC USC 9-2 0.596910
9 Notre Dame Notre Dame 8-2 0.588513
10 Penn State Penn State 8-2 0.587236
11 Ohio State Ohio State 8-2 0.586727
12 Memphis Memphis 8-1 0.585124
13 Boise State Boise State 8-2 0.583462
14 Michigan Michigan 8-2 0.582554
15 Oklahoma State Oklahoma State 8-2 0.582454
16 Washington State Washington State 9-2 0.582083
17 South Florida South Florida 8-1 0.577032
18 TCU TCU 8-2 0.574353
19 Auburn Auburn 8-2 0.574293
20 Washington Washington 8-2 0.571059
21 San Diego State San Diego State 8-2 0.570475
22 Toledo Toledo 8-2 0.569525
23 Troy Troy 8-2 0.566354
24 Army Army 8-2 0.566037
25 Michigan State Michigan State 7-3 0.564476

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.